Exclusive deal between Libsyn's Advertisecast and The Newsworthy! Pros and cons on shipping a microphone to your guests, how Twitter can become the world's number-one podcast platform, sharing YouTube stats for The Feed, comments on AI from Spotify, automatic silencing from Auphonic, the best microphone for wireless buds per The Verge and as always, stats: geographic and user agent
